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

Benchmark coverage: 68%

Celeron J4105 2907
+50.5%
A10-4600M 1932

Celeron J4105 outperforms A10-4600M by 50% in Passmark.

Cinebench 15 64-bit single-core

Cinebench R15 (standing for Release 15) is a benchmark made by Maxon, authors of Cinema 4D. It was superseded by later versions of Cinebench, which use more modern variants of Cinema 4D engine. The Single Core version (sometimes called Single-Thread) only uses a single processor thread to render a room full of reflective spheres and light sources.

Benchmark coverage: 15%

Celeron J4105 73
+15.9%
A10-4600M 63

Celeron J4105 outperforms A10-4600M by 16% in Cinebench 15 64-bit single-core.
